quarta-feira, 6 de novembro de 2019

Algoritmos Ghunter Lista 2 - For - Array Vetor e Matriz - ex 04

#include <iostream>
using namespace std;
// Matheus Nakade Lista 2 - EX 04

int main() { 

    int A[20],L;
   
  
// lE os 20 numeros inteiros do vetor A
    for(L=0;L<20;L++)
    {      
        cin>>A[L];  
  
    }      
 
// mostra os 20 numeros do vetor A
    cout<<" "<<endl;   
    cout<<"O Vetor Digita e: "<<endl;   
    for(L=0;L<20;L++)
    {
       
         cout<<A[L]<<" ";
        
      
    }
      
// altera os numeros pares por 0  

    for(L=0;L<20;L++)
    {
    
    for(L=0;L<20;L++)
    {
        if(A[L]%2 == 0)
        {
            A[L]=0;
        }
    }
   
// mostra os 20 numeros do vetor A aletando os vetores que são pares para 0
    cout<<" "<<endl;
    cout<<"A Seguir o vetor alterado: "<<endl;
    for(L=0;L<20;L++)
    {
       
         cout<<A[L]<<" ";
        
      
    }
}
  
  
  
    cout<<"Fim do Programa"<<endl;
  
    return 0;

}

Algoritmos Ghunter Lista 2 - For - Array Vetor e Matriz - ex 01


1)
#include <iostream>

using namespace std;
// Matheus Nakade Lista 2 - EX 01


int main() {  
           
            int f1,f2,i,x;
            float media, soma;
           
           
            cout<<"Digite o primeiro numero da sequencia Fib: "<<endl;
            cin>>f1;
            cout<<"Digite o segundo numero da sequencia Fib: "<<endl;
            cin>>f2;
            cout<<endl;
           
           
cout<<f1<<endl;
cout<<f2<<endl;
soma = f1 + f2;
   
    for(i=2;i<15;i++)
    {
            x = f1 + f2;
            cout<<x<<endl;
            soma = soma + x;
           
            f1 = f2;
            f2 = x;

            }
           
            media = (soma)/15;
            cout<<"Soma dos 15 primeiros termos da sequancia Fib: "<<soma<<endl;
            cout<<"Media dos 15 primeiros termos da sequencia Fib: " <<media<<endl;
           
           
           
   return 0;
   

}

matriz 3 ler peleo teclado valores pro array e printa na tela

#include <iostream>
using namespace std;

int main() {  

    int matriz[3][4];
    int L, C;
   
    // inserir os valores pelo teclado
    for(L=0;L<3;L++)
    {
        for(C=0;C<4;C++)
        {
        cin>>matriz[L][C];
        }
   
   
    }
   
   
    // for que imprime os valores da matriz
    for(L=0;L<3;L++)
    {
        for(C=0;C<4;C++)
        {
            cout<<matriz[L][C]<<" ";
        }
        cout << "\n";
    }
   
   

   
    return 0;

}

matriz 2 indice do lugar para dar o valor

#include <iostream>
using namespace std;

int main() {  

    int matriz[3][4];
    int L, C;
   
    // lendo os valores para as variaveis da matriz
    for(L=0;L<3;L++)
    {
        for(C=0;C<4;C++)
        {
            matriz[L][C]=L;
        }
   
   
    }
   
   
    // for que imprime os valores da matriz
    for(L=0;L<3;L++)
    {
        for(C=0;C<4;C++)
        {
            cout<<matriz[L][C]<<" ";
        }
        cout << "\n";
    }
   
   

   
    return 0;

}

matriz 1 array bidimencional array de array linha e coluna

#include <iostream>
using namespace std;

int main() {  

    int matriz[3][4];
    int L, C;
   
   
    matriz[0][0]=0;
    matriz[0][1]=0;
    matriz[0][2]=0;
    matriz[0][3]=0;
   
    matriz[1][0]=1;
    matriz[1][1]=1;
    matriz[1][2]=1;
    matriz[1][3]=1;
   
    matriz[2][0]=2;
    matriz[2][1]=2;
    matriz[2][2]=2;
    matriz[2][3]=2;
   
    for(L=0;L<3;L++)
    {
        for(C=0;C<4;C++)
        {
            cout<<matriz[L][C]<<" ";
        }
        cout << "\n";
    }
   
   

   
    return 0;

}